What causes an "out of round" tire? Could this be my problem- and if so will it "right-itself" in time?
There are a number of different specs all called "out-of-round".
  1. Truely out of round means an oval-shaped tire. Different diameters in different places.
  2. Eccentric. A perfectly round tire where the outside (tread) is offset from the inside (bead).
  3. Flat spot. Can be easily mistaken for #1.
If it's been sitting for a while, it may get better with time. Make sure you let whomever you purchased it from know there is a problem and might be willing to give it a little time. Document your complaint. Make sure some "time limit" or "milage limit" doesn't expire before it/they are replaced.
